What is a Content Brief and Why Do You Need One?

A content brief is essentially a thorough document that defines the parameters for a fresh piece of content . It’s exceeding just a topic ; it provides essential details to confirm the ultimate product matches with overall goals and resonates with the desired audience. Lacking one, writers might find difficulty to develop valuable work, resulting in missed opportunities and possibly a product that won't precisely what's required . Therefore, a well-crafted content brief is vital for successful content efforts.

Topic Briefing Best Practices: A Detailed Checklist

To secure article quality and harmony with business objectives, a carefully prepared content briefing is crucial. This guide outlines key aspects to incorporate in your briefing. Start by specifying the target audience and their pain points. Next, distinctly state the goal of the material - is it to inform, convince, or amuse? Don’t forget to specify the phrases for SEO, the desired tone and style, and any pertinent examples. Include directions regarding length, format, and external resources. Finally, designate a due date and a liaison for questions. Following this approach will considerably improve article creation and outcomes.
